WebThe Diabetic Association of Australia was formed in 1938. In 1956 the Diabetes Federation of Australia was formed and New South Wales changed its name to the Diabetic Association of NSW. In 2010, the name was changed to the Australian Diabetes Council, but in April 2014, after a change in the leadership, the organisation became known as ... She has successfully supervised post graduate students from a variety of health related faculties and has received over $500,000 in … WebTo help you manage your diabetes, the NDSS gives you access to a range of subsidised products. These products include: blood glucose monitoring strips (restrictions apply to people with type 2 diabetes who do not use insulin) urine monitoring strips; insulin pump consumables (if you have type 1 diabetes and meet the eligibility criteria)
